Marriott/Bulgari Lux Brand
Marriott is launching Bulgari Hotels & Resorts, a joint venture with Italian jeweler Bulgari SpA. The luxury portfolio will start with up to seven hotels in prime locations around the world. Sites under consideration include London, Rome, Paris, New York, Miami, and Southern California. Bulgari Hotels & Resorts and Marriott's existing luxury brand, Ritz-Carlton, will be headed by William R. Tiefel, vice chairman of Marriott International.

AIME High
The 9th Annual AsiaPacific Incentives & Meeting Expo took place at the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re in Australia in February. AIME, the third-largest meeting event in the world, was organized for the first time this year by Reed Travel Exhibitions. Exhibitions included product and services from 62 countries. GEP Plus One
Global Events Partners (www.globaleventspartners.com), a consortium of 40 international and domestic destination management companies, has added The Event Network Inc., a Washingon, D.C. area — based DMC.
Regal No More
Millennium Hotels and Resorts renamed its Regal hotel properties Millennium in early April. Millennium Hotels and Resorts, which acquired Regal in 1999, is the North American unit of London-based Millennium and Copthorne Hotels plc.
